.headshot-quote{margin:auto auto 4.8rem;max-width:36.5rem}@media screen and (min-width:769px){.headshot-quote{max-width:50%;padding:0}}@media screen and (min-width:1024px){.headshot-quote{max-width:65%}}.headshot-quote__content{display:flex;flex-direction:column}@media screen and (min-width:1024px){.headshot-quote__content{flex-direction:column}}.headshot-quote__image{border-radius:50%;height:12rem;-o-object-fit:cover;object-fit:cover;width:12rem}@media screen and (min-width:1024px){.headshot-quote__image{margin-right:3rem}}.headshot-quote__text-flex{align-items:center;display:flex;flex-direction:column;margin:0 auto;padding:2rem 0}@media screen and (min-width:1024px){.headshot-quote__text-flex{align-items:flex-start;flex-direction:row}}.headshot-quote__credit{display:block}.headshot-quote__quote-flex{display:none;max-width:100%}@media screen and (min-width:1024px){.headshot-quote__quote-flex{display:flex;justify-content:end}}.headshot-quote__text{margin-bottom:2.4rem;margin-top:2.4rem}.headshot-quote__quote-flex--top--mobile{align-items:flex-start;display:flex;flex-direction:column;width:100%}@media screen and (min-width:769px){.headshot-quote__quote-flex--top--mobile{align-items:center;max-width:55%}}@media screen and (min-width:1024px){.headshot-quote__quote-flex--top--mobile{display:none}.headshot-quote--is-quote-only{max-width:50%}}.headshot-quote--is-quote-only .headshot-quote__image{display:none}
